Understanding motor power and torque requirements for heavy material removal
The ability to remove material efficiently hinges on the motor’s capacity to maintain torque under load. In heavy-duty grinding, standard induction motors must provide sufficient power to prevent the belt from bogging down upon contact. Selecting an industrial belt sander with an oversized motor is a common strategy to ensure the industrial belt grinder runs cool and maintains consistent material removal rates across multi-shift cycles.
Belt tensioning systems and tracking accuracy for consistent finish quality
Precise belt tracking is the backbone of repeatable finishing. Relying on pneumatic tensioning systems allows for quick, tool-free belt swaps while maintaining the constant tension required for uniform surface contact. When belts wander on the contact wheel, the resulting finish patterns become inconsistent, potentially leading to costly surface defects that require secondary processing to correct.
Variable speed drives for diverse materials and surface finish applications
Modern metalworking demands versatility, particularly when shops toggle between abrasive grit types and material hardness. Variable speed drives allow operators to tune surface speed to minimize heat buildup on volatile alloys while extending the lifespan of the abrasive media. Controlling the surface feet per minute ensures that your finishing results meet specific Ra values without overheating the workpiece.

Identifying the role of CNC-machined frames in vibration reduction
CNC milling of the main chassis eliminates the uneven stress points found in lower-quality cast or welded frames. By utilizing precision-aligned base plates, these industrial belt grinders dampen the harmonic vibrations generated during aggressive material removal. This level of build quality allows operators to push the machine harder while maintaining tight tolerances on complex geometries.
Material thickness and frame rigidity to prevent machine chatter
Frame wall thickness directly correlates to a unit’s ability to withstand continuous shock loads. The following comparison illustrates how industrial-grade frames outperform standard fabrication equipment in typical metalworking benchmarks.
| Specification | Industrial-Grade Frame | Standard Fabricated Frame |
|---|---|---|
| Material Thickness | 12mm+ Steel Plate | 6mm to 8mm Steel |
| Vibration Dampening | High (Inertial Mass) | Low (Subject to Resonant Frequency) |
| Load Durability | Multi-Shift Production | Intermittent Single-Shift |
By prioritizing higher-density materials, shop managers can suppress machine chatter effectively, extending the life of the entire drive train and abrasive system.
Precision alignment of contact wheels and platen surfaces for surface uniformity
If the contact wheel—the heart of the grinding assembly—is misaligned by even a fraction of a degree, surface uniformity is impossible to achieve. Precision bearing housings and hardened shaft assemblies are essential for keeping these contact points perfectly parallel to the work surface. When these components are manufactured to high standards, the transition of the abrasive path remains perfectly flat across the entire part.
Wear-resistant components for continuous, heavy-duty operation environments
High-production environments are harsh, with metal dust acting as a constant abrasive agent. Utilizing hardened alloys for pulleys, belt guards, and tracking guides prevents premature wear that ruins machine accuracy. Dust extraction capabilities and particulate filtration efficiency
Metal dust creates significant environmental and health risks that require dedicated extraction solutions. A machine with an integrated, high-CFM dust collection port ensures that fine particulates remain out of the operator’s breathing zone and away from internal electrical components. Efficient filtration is a key requirement for maximizing efficiency in your production.
Emergency stop integration and electrical safety interlocks
Safety interlocks should disconnect the power the instant an access door is opened or a fault is detected. This prevents accidental contact with active grinding belts, which travel at high speeds. These controls must be tested regularly to ensure they remain functional throughout years of heavy-duty operation.
